Chicken Tortilla Soup


Chicken Tortilla Soup
Adapted from this recipe found on Allrecipes.com

  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 red pepper, chopped
  • 1 Tbsp olive oil
  • salt and pepper
  • 1 large can (28 oz) crushed tomatoes
  • 2 cans (14 oz) chicken broth (feel free to add more or less depending on how soupy you like it)
  • 1 can corn (you can use frozen too)
  • 1 can black beans
  • 1 can white hominy (I didn't have any on hand, but will definitely add them next time!)
  • 1 can (4 oz) diced green chiles
  • cooked, shredded chicken...I used 1/2 a whole chicken
  • 1 tsp chili powder
  • 1 tsp cumin
  • 1 tsp oregano
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• juice of 1 lime
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
Toppings
  • tortilla chips 
  • sour cream
  • avocado (I didn't have an avocado either...would've been so good on it though!)
  • shredded cheese (pepperjack would be awesome, but I used a taco blend...it's what we had)

Cook your chicken any way you like.  I roasted a whole chicken in the oven today and then shredded it up to put in the soup.  Next, saute the onions, red pepper and garlic in the olive oil and salt and pepper till onions are translucent and red pepper is semi-soft...not mushy.  Add tomatoes, chicken broth, corn, black beans, hominy, green chiles, chicken, chili powder, cumin, oregano and garlic powder.  Simmer for 1/2 hour.  Add lime juice and cilantro.  Simmer another 15 minutes.  Serve with crushed up tortilla chips, sour cream, avocados, shredded cheese, anything you like.  Other toppings could include sliced black olives, chopped green onion, get creative!  Another fun thing is to squeeze a little lime juice over your soup bowl right before you eat it...yum!  Also, you can spice this soup up a bit more if you'd like.  I kept ours at a mild level since the boys would be eating it, but it would be great spicier too.
